How super-rich Americans fled to New Zealand to stay in their lavish doomsday survival shelters duri


Super-rich Americans have fled to New Zealand to hide out in their luxury bunkers throughout the coronavirus pandemic.

Quick-thinking Silicon Valley billionaires booked flights for New Zealand as soon as the COVID-19 crisis began to escalate.

A number of executives managed to escape shortly before the country closed its borders to almost all travellers on March 16.

Just weeks ago, doomsday bunker manufacturer, Rising S Co, got a desperate call from an executive based in New York - the epicentre of the outbreak in the US - asking how to open the secret door to his shelter.

His bunker, 11 feet underground in New Zealand, has never been used.

'He wanted to verify the combination for the door and was asking questions about the power and the hot water heater and whether he needed to take extra water or air filters,' Gary Lynch, general manager of Texas-based company told Bloomberg.

'He went out to New Zealand to escape everything that's happening.

'And as far as I know, he's still there.'

By Charlotte Graham-McLay
June 8, 2018

WELLINGTON, New Zealand — Matt Lauer, the former “Today” show co-host who lost his job over sexual misconduct allegations, will be allowed to keep his ranch in New Zealand, after a government agency said Friday it did not have sufficient evidence he had breached a good-character test for foreign property buyers.
